The dental industry represents a highly attractive market for consolidation. Being greatly fragmented , made up of approximately 10 000 dentists and dental specialists with in excess of $4 billion in annual revenue, dentistry provides an ideal opportunity for consolidation and corporatisation. Dentistry also offers an attractive economic structure with high gross margins and strong cash flow.
The potential benefits to be gained for both practices and dentists who participate in a corporate model are significant, these will also overflow into the industry as a whole as one or a number of consolidators achieve a scale increasing their investment in their business and the growth of the industry.
These benefits include:
- Increased value of dental practices
- Improved and streamlined administrative functions
- Improved training and professional development for dentists and support staff
- Defined career paths for young dentists
- Defined succession planning

Dental Corporation has to date acquired over 40 practices in Australia, within NSW, QLD, SA and VIC and
intend to double this in the next few months, and double this number again before the end of 2009. Dental
Corporation is set to expand its breadth across Australia and potentially NZ and beyond. According to Dr
Khouri, the success of Dental Corporation to date has resulted due to fact that they are ‘partnering with the
best practices in the country effectively building a critical foundation for sustainable growth’.
